The Senior Healthcare Economics Analyst will support United Retiree Solutions (URS) Strategic Growth, Reporting and Analytics (SGRA) teams’ analytic needs. This position will partner with the Associate Director to extract, analyze and interpret Healthcare data to uncover trends. This role will also assist in managing and understanding the customers' Medical and Pharmacy Cost trends. The role offers a unique blend of support for internal teams such as Actuarial and Finance, as well as customer-facing teams, such as Sales and Account Management.

 

The Senior Analyst will be responsible for Medical and Pharmacy financial and utilization reporting.

 

The individual must be able to extract, aggregate and QA applicable data for measurement purposes leveraging existing or creating ad-hoc reporting capabilities to identify trends in health plan performance.

 

This position will work with very large data sets and see projects from conceptualization to completion by contributing to database creation, statistical modeling, and financial reports.

 

Primary Responsibilities:

  • Apply critical thinking skills to anticipate questions from key stakeholders and consider all aspects of an analysis before completion
  • Use SAS/SQL to construct claims-based datasets
  • Construct polished MS Excel models to satisfy analytical requests
  • Provide ongoing, meaningful, communications to managers on project status, results and conclusions from analyses
  • Identify, analyze, and explain Medicare medical trends using claims-based analyses
  • Understand and interpret key drivers of health care trends (i.e. medical cost trends, utilization, etc.), clinical program performance, and potential opportunities for medical cost reduction or program improvement
  • Build strong relationships within the organization including finance, network pricing, product, actuarial/underwriting, clinical, and operations teams as well as other areas to create a connection between medical trend evaluations and financial results
  • Update reports to support trend analysis

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's Degree in Healthcare Administration, Actuarial Math, Statistics, Economics, or a related field
  • Intermediate or higher level of proficiency with MS Excel (practical experience working with pivot tables, advanced formulas, graphs, vlookups) and PowerPoint
  • Ability to pay attention to detail and ensure accuracy of work

 

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Advanced Degree
  • 2+ years of applicable corporate or academic experience in data analytics-examining and summarizing data to uncover insights
  • Claims analytics experience
  • Experience working with large Data sets
  • Experience with SAS/SQL and/or other statistical software
  • VBA knowledge 
  • Team oriented and motivated to collaborate
  • Proactive problem-solving abilities
